Bomber Kills 25 in Baghdad Suicide Attack
Twenty-five people were killed yesterday when a suicide bomber blew up a truck full of explosives outside a police station in Baghdad, Iraqi officials said, but the US military put the death toll at 40. âThe bodies of the victims, many of whom were policemen, were completely burned by the blast,â an Interior Ministry official said, adding that 33 others were wounded.
The US military, citing initial Iraqi police reports, said 40 people were killed, but police said they were uncertain where the figure came from. The US military said the suicide bomber used a semi-truck loaded with 220 kilograms of explosives. Twenty-two cars, 10 shops and a residential building were set ablaze in the massive explosion outside Al-Rashid police station in the Al-Mashtel neighborhood in the southeast of the capital. âIt appears that the bomber who was driving the truck wanted to enter the police station, but for some reason the explosives detonated 20 meters before the police station,â the official said, adding that US and Iraqi security forces had cordoned off the area. It was the deadliest attack in Iraq since a suicide bomber blew himself up near a Shiite mosque on July 16 in the central city of Musayyib, igniting a fuel tanker and killing nearly 100 people.
